/**
* Differentiates different kinds of `AttributeCompletion`s.
*/
export declare enum AttributeCompletionKind {
/**
* Completion of an attribute from the HTML schema.
*
* Attributes often have a corresponding DOM property of the same name.
*/
DomAttribute = 0,
/**
* Completion of a property from the DOM schema.
*
* `DomProperty` completions are generated only for properties which don't share their name with
* an HTML attribute.
*/
DomProperty = 1,
/**
* Completion of an attribute that results in a new directive being matched on an element.
*/
DirectiveAttribute = 2,
/**
* Completion of an attribute that results in a new structural directive being matched on an
* element.
*/
StructuralDirectiveAttribute = 3,
/**
* Completion of an input from a directive which is either present on the element, or becomes
* present after the addition of this attribute.
*/
DirectiveInput = 4,
/**
* Completion of an output from a directive which is either present on the element, or becomes
* present after the addition of this attribute.
*/
DirectiveOutput = 5
}
/**
* Completion of an attribute from the DOM schema.
*/
export interface DomAttributeCompletion {
kind: AttributeCompletionKind.DomAttribute;
/**
* Name of the HTML attribute (not to be confused with the corresponding DOM property name).
*/
attribute: string;
/**
* Whether this attribute is also a DOM property.
*/
isAlsoProperty: boolean;
}
/**
* Completion of a DOM property of an element that's distinct from an HTML attribute.
*/
export interface DomPropertyCompletion {
kind: AttributeCompletionKind.DomProperty;
/**
* Name of the DOM property
*/
property: string;
}
/**
* Completion of an attribute which results in a new directive being matched on an element.
*/
export interface DirectiveAttributeCompletion {
kind: AttributeCompletionKind.DirectiveAttribute | AttributeCompletionKind.StructuralDirectiveAttribute;
/**
* Name of the attribute whose addition causes this directive to match the element.
*/
attribute: string;
/**
* The directive whose selector gave rise to this completion.
*/
directive: DirectiveInScope;
}
/**
* Completion of an input of a directive which may either be present on the element, or become
* present when a binding to this input is added.
*/
export interface DirectiveInputCompletion {
kind: AttributeCompletionKind.DirectiveInput;
/**
* The public property name of the input (the name which would be used in any binding to that
* input).
*/
propertyName: string;
/**
* The directive which has this input.
*/
directive: DirectiveInScope;
/**
* The field name on the directive class which corresponds to this input.
*
* Currently, in the case where a single property name corresponds to multiple input fields, only
* the first such field is represented here. In the future multiple results may be warranted.
*/
classPropertyName: string;
/**
* Whether this input can be used with two-way binding (that is, whether a corresponding change
* output exists on the directive).
*/
twoWayBindingSupported: boolean;
}
export interface DirectiveOutputCompletion {
kind: AttributeCompletionKind.DirectiveOutput;
/**
* The public event name of the output (the name which would be used in any binding to that
* output).
*/
eventName: string;
/**
*The directive which has this output.
*/
directive: DirectiveInScope;
/**
* The field name on the directive class which corresponds to this output.
*/
classPropertyName: string;
}
/**
* Any named attribute which is available for completion on a given element.
*
* Disambiguated by the `kind` property into various types of completions.
*/
export declare type AttributeCompletion = DomAttributeCompletion | DomPropertyCompletion | DirectiveAttributeCompletion | DirectiveInputCompletion | DirectiveOutputCompletion;
/**
* Given an element and its context, produce a `Map` of all possible attribute completions.
*
* 3 kinds of attributes are considered for completion, from highest to lowest priority:
*
* 1. Inputs/outputs of directives present on the element already.
* 2. Inputs/outputs of directives that are not present on the element, but which would become
* present if such a binding is added.
* 3. Attributes from the DOM schema for the element.
*
* The priority of these options determines which completions are added to the `Map`. If a directive
* input shares the same name as a DOM attribute, the `Map` will reflect the directive input
* completion, not the DOM completion for that name.
*/
export declare function buildAttributeCompletionTable(component: ts.ClassDeclaration, element: TmplAstElement | TmplAstTemplate, checker: TemplateTypeChecker): Map;
